lanny Edmonton to host 2023 Heritage Classic: Flames expected to be opponent

Quote:
The game is scheduled to be played in October 2023. The date hasn’t been finalized and neither has the opponent. But it should be the Calgary Flames. I expect it will be. The plan is to have an alumni game as well, similar to what they did in 2003. But expect a younger wave of alumni to lace up their skates than the ones you watched 20 years ago — players like Ryan Smyth, Doug Weight, Jason Smith, and Dwayne Roloson for the Oilers, and you could see the likes of Jarome Iginla, Robyn Regehr, Craig Conroy and others in red and yellow.
